How much does it cost to rent an apartment in 94066?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| 94066 Studio Apartments | $2,688 | $2,128 | $2,923 |
| 94066 1 Bedroom Apartments | $3,093 | $2,075 | $5,124 |
| 94066 2 Bedroom Apartments | $3,846 | $2,725 | $7,752 |
| 94066 3 Bedroom Apartments | $4,545 | $3,500 | $4,980 |

Frequently Asked Questions about the 94066 ZIP Code
How much are Studio apartments in 94066?
There are currently 224 Studio Apartments in 94066 with rent ranges from $2,128 to $2,923 with an average price of $2,688.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om 94066 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in 94066 ranges from $2,075 to $5,124 with an average monthly rent of $3,093.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in 94066 c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in 94066 range from $2,725 to $7,752.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$3,846.
How expensive are 94066 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 60 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in 94066 on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$3,500 to $4,980 - averaging $4,545 for the location.
